The Administrative Office programs are designed to provide the skills and competencies needed to become an efficient, productive member of an office support team. Courses are designed to help students learn to analyze and coordinate office duties and systems, develop proficiency in the use of integrated software, and improve oral and written communication. Emphasis is placed on non-technical as well as technical skills. Students have the option of completing certificates and/or a two-year degree program. Designed to prepare the student for employment as office support staff to assist managers, executives, and professionals.To Achieve the Certificate of Achievement. Upon completion of the following courses with at least a āCā grade in each course, the student will be awarded an Office Assistant Certificate of Achievement

1. Upon successful completion of the program, the student will be able to illustrate effective communication within a business environment.
2. Upon successful completion of the program, the student will be able to participate in office related activities to achieve the following desirable job qualities:
3. Upon successful completion of the program, the student will be able to demonstrate minimum acceptable skills in ten-key, keyboarding, and document processing.
The certificate is the core courses for a student to gain skills to be employable. They are also the stepping stone to the A degree that these course in addition to the general education will get a student the AA degree.
